
想象一下,你家里的书架上放着各种各样的书籍,有适合所有家庭成员阅读的科普读物,也有只适合你自己翻阅的个人日记和重要文件。你肯定不会允许客人随意翻看你的日记,同样,在公司或团队中,知识库就如同这个书架,里面既有可以公开共享的信息,也包含敏感的、需要严格保密的资料。如何确保这些信息能被合适的人,在合适的场景下访问,就成了一个动态且关键的管理课题。简单地将权限设定为一成不变是远远不够的,因为人员角色、项目阶段甚至安全需求都在不断变化。知识库访问权限的动态调整,正是为了解决这一挑战而生,它意味着权限管理不再是“设定后即忘记”的一次性操作,而是一个能够响应内外部变化、持续优化的智能流程。
小浣熊AI助手观察到,一个灵活、智能的权限管理体系,不仅能保障信息安全,更能提升团队的协作效率和知识的流动性。接下来,我们将从几个核心方面深入探讨,如何实现知识库访问权限的动态化调整。
一、 理解权限调整的动因

权限需要动态调整,根本原因在于我们所处的环境是动态的。静态的权限划分就像给每个房间上了一把固定的锁,一旦人员职责发生变化,要么打不开新任务的门,要么还保留着旧房间的钥匙,带来安全隐患或协作障碍。
具体来看,推动权限调整的动因多种多样。首先是人员角色的变动。新员工入职、老员工离职、员工内部转岗或晋升,这些常见的人事变动都直接关联到其所需访问的知识范围。一名刚从市场部转到产品部的员工,应立即取消其对市场核心策略文档的编辑权限,同时授予其访问产品设计文档和用户反馈库的权限。其次是项目生命周期的演进。一个项目从立项、研发、测试到上线运营,不同阶段涉及的团队成员和所需知识截然不同。在立项初期,可能只有核心产品经理和架构师需要访问相关文档;进入开发阶段后,全体研发人员都需要读写权限;而上线后,运维和支持团队则成为主要的知识使用者。忽视这种阶段性变化,权限管理就会与实际工作脱节。
二、 构建动态权限模型
要实现动态调整,首先需要一个强大而灵活的权限模型作为基础。传统的自主访问控制(DAC)模型,将权限直接赋予用户,管理起来非常繁琐。而基于角色的访问控制(RBAC)模型及其增强版,是目前实现动态权限管理的核心。
RBAC模型的核心思想是“用户-角色-权限”的分离。管理员不直接管理成千上万个用户的具体权限,而是先定义好一系列角色(如“项目经理”、“开发工程师”、“实习生”),并为每个角色分配相应的权限。用户通过被赋予一个或多个角色来间接获得权限。当需要调整权限时,管理员只需修改角色所包含的权限,所有属于该角色的用户的权限就会自动更新,这极大地简化了管理。更进一步,可以引入属性基访问控制(ABAC)模型,它考虑更多动态属性,如用户部门、访问时间、地理位置、设备安全状态等,从而实现更细粒度和上下文相关的权限控制。例如,可以设置规则:“允许‘开发工程师’角色,在‘工作日的9点到18点’且‘从公司内网’访问‘项目代码库’”。小浣熊AI助手可以集成这些模型,通过智能策略引擎自动执行这些复杂规则。

| 模型类型 | 核心原理 | 动态调整优势 |
|---|---|---|
| RBAC (基于角色) | 权限与角色绑定,用户通过担任角色获得权限。 | 人员变动时,只需调整用户与角色的关联,权限批量生效。 |
| ABAC (基于属性) | 根据用户、资源、环境等多种属性的组合策略来决定访问。 | 可根据实时上下文(如时间、地点、项目状态)动态授予或回收权限。 |
三、 自动化调整的关键技术
有了科学的模型,下一步就是通过技术手段实现调整的自动化,减少人工干预,提高准确性和效率。自动化是“动态”一词的技术体现。
一个关键的连接点是与人力资源系统(HR系统)或活跃目录(AD)的集成。当员工信息在HR系统中发生变更时(如部门调动),系统可以自动触发事件通知知识库平台。小浣熊AI助手可以监听这些事件,并调用权限管理接口,自动完成用户角色的更新和解绑。例如,一旦HR系统标记某员工转入新部门,AI助手即刻移除其旧部门的角色,添加新部门的角色,实现权限的“无缝切换”。另一个重要技术是基于策略的自动化引擎。管理员可以预设一系列“如果…那么…”的策略规则。例如:“如果一个项目的状态从‘开发中’变为‘已上线’,那么自动收回所有‘开发人员’对该项目知识库的‘写入’权限,并仅为‘运维团队’角色开放‘读取’权限。” 这种基于事件和策略的自动化,确保了权限调整的及时性和准确性。
- 事件监听: 实时监控人员、项目等关键信息的变更事件。
- 策略执行: 根据预定义的规则库,自动执行权限的授予、修改或撤销。
- 日志与审计: 记录每一次权限变动的操作者、时间、原因,满足合规要求。
四、 融入时间与审批流程
动态调整不仅是对已发生变化的响应,还可以是带有预见性的管理。将时间维度和审批流程融入权限管理,能使其更具智慧。
基于时间的权限是一种非常实用的动态策略。它可以用于临时访问的场景,比如为协作的第三方顾问设置一个为期三个月的知识库访问权限,时间一到,权限自动失效,无需手动回收。它也适用于实习生、短期项目成员等。此外,还可以设置定期权限审查机制。小浣熊AI助手可以定期(如每季度)自动生成报告,列出哪些用户拥有某些高权限角色,或者哪些长期未使用的账号依然拥有访问权限,并发送提醒给管理员或部门负责人进行确认。这种周期性审查是防止权限冗余和“权限蔓延”的有效手段。
对于某些敏感权限的申请,完全自动化可能不够审慎,这时就需要集成审批工作流。当员工需要申请一个超出其当前角色的权限时,可以通过系统提交申请,请求会按照预设的流程(如需要直属经理和知识库管理员两级审批)流转。审批通过后,系统自动授予权限,并可以同样设置一个有效期。这种方式既保证了灵活性,又确保了安全可控。
五、 持续优化与安全审计
动态权限管理体系本身也需要被持续监控和优化,形成一个闭环。这并不是一次性的项目,而是一个长期的运维过程。
强大的日志记录与审计功能是优化的基础。系统需要详细记录谁、在什么时候、访问了什么内容、执行了什么操作(读、写、删、下载),以及所有权限变更的历史。小浣熊AI助手可以对这些日志进行智能分析,发现异常访问模式,例如某个账号在非工作时间频繁下载大量敏感文档,系统可以自动告警。此外,通过分析权限的使用情况,可以发现哪些权限被过度授予(很多人有权限但从不使用)或授予不足(很多人需要临时申请),从而为权限模型的优化提供数据支持。
最后,定期评估和调整权限策略至关重要。业务在发展,组织在变革,一年前制定的权限策略可能已不再适用。管理层应定期回顾权限管理的效果,结合审计日志和分析报告,审视现有的角色定义和策略规则是否仍然合理。这是一个持续改进的过程,确保知识库的权限体系始终与组织的实际需求保持一致。
总结与展望
总而言之,知识库访问权限的动态调整是一个涉及管理理念、技术模型和自动化工具的综合性课题。它要求我们从静态的、粗放式的权限管理,转向动态的、精细化的智能治理。核心在于建立以RBAC/ABAC为代表的灵活模型,并通过与HR系统集成、策略引擎、时间控制和工作流审批等技术实现自动化,最后辅以持续的日志审计和策略优化,形成一个完整的生命周期管理。
展望未来,随着人工智能技术的深入应用,权限管理将变得更加智能和预测性。例如,小浣熊AI助手未来或许能够通过学习用户的工作习惯和项目上下文,智能推荐最合适的权限套餐,或者在风险发生前预测并阻断潜在的越权行为。无论如何,构建一个动态、智能、安全的知识访问环境,对于释放知识价值、保障企业信息安全、提升协同效率,都具有不可替代的重要性。建议组织在规划知识库时,将权限的动态管理能力作为一项核心特性来考量,从而让知识真正安全、高效地流动起来。




















